Seven Stages of Money Maturity®

"George Kinder's work provides us with a psycho-spiritual model of adult development using money as a portal. We all experience each of these stages every day. Each money story in our personal autobiography contains elements of each stage. At various times in our lives, to give special attention to a particular stage can allow us to be more effective in growing toward our life goals Without this work, we too easily sabotage even the most brilliantly designed financial plans."

Sally Jo Button

  1. Innocence - the belief systems around money learned in childhood; partial and incomplete truths.
  2. Pain - the difficult feelings around money. Innocent messages cycle with difficult feelings to sabotage implementation of even the most brilliantly designed financial plans.
  3. Knowledge - the practical information and skills needed to accomplish our financial goals. This is the information you expect from traditional Financial Planners.
  4. Understanding- the act of transforming our painful money dilemmas. Through the work of the maturing adult, a sense of ease develops as we learn to let the thoughts go and let the feelings be.
  5. Vigor - the energy and enthusiasm to accomplish our financial goals. Gaining "voice" results by tapping into the motivation behind our core values and our hearts' desires.
  6. Vision - the ability to see what needs to be done in our community and having the skills to take sustained visionary action.
  7. Aloha - the passing of a blessing from one person to another without regard to economic differences; true and untainted generosity.
